Marvin taught fifth and sixth grade at McComb local schools. He was the past principal at Seneca East and Lima City Schools, and past assistant principal at Elmwood Local school. Marvin coached junior high and varsity football, boys and girls junior high basketball at McComb, along with his daughters t-ball and softball teams.
Marvin was a member of the McComb Lions Club and past District Governor for MD13A. He enjoyed traveling, working in the yard, and cheering on the Ohio State Buckeyes, the Cleveland Indians, Browns, and Cavaliers. His greatest love was his family.
Marvin is survived by his wife, Deborah; daughters, Jessica L. (Kenton) Reichley, Alyssa G.(Eric) Hauff, and Katharyn M. Buckingham; grandchildren, Blair and Jase Reichley, and Brinley Hauff; sister, Kim Crawford; brother, Stephen (Mary Ann) Crawford; and a sister-in-law, Margaret Fackler. He was also preceded in death by a brother, Tony Crawford.
Friends and family may visit on Friday, July 7, 2017, from 12:00 – 4 p.m. at HUFFORD FAMILY FUNERAL HOME, 1500 Manor Hill Rd, Findlay (419-422-1500). A Celebration of Life service will follow at 4 p.m. at the funeral home. Memorial contributions in Marvin’s name may be made to the McComb High School Athletic Department, the McComb Lions Club, or to Bridge Home Health and Hospice.
